Community Profile

The community surrounding Morgan Township Elementary School has a median household income of $75,575. It is an area where 38%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$258,400, with a median rent of $1,144/month. The area has a poverty rate of 11.6%. The average commute for residents is 24 minutes.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about Morgan Township Elementary School

What grades does Morgan Township Elementary School serve?

Morgan Township Elementary School serves students in grades Kindergarten through 5th.

How many students attend Morgan Township Elementary School?

Morgan Township Elementary School has an enrollment of approximately 346 students.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Morgan Township Elementary School?

The student-teacher ratio at Morgan Township Elementary School is 15: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 16:1 for public schools.

Is Morgan Township Elementary School a charter school?

No, Morgan Township Elementary School is not a charter school. It is a traditional public school operated by the local school district.

Is Morgan Township Elementary School a Title I school?

No, Morgan Township Elementary School is not currently a Title I school.

What does the Free & Reduced Lunch percentage mean for Morgan Township Elementary School?

14.5% of students at Morgan Township Elementary School q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. This is a commonly used indicator of economic need and provides important context when interpreting test scores.
